What is existential risk? In the context of artificial intelligence, existential risk refers to scenarios where AI could cause, intentionally or unintentionally, severe harm or even the extinction of humanity. This encompasses risks arising from advanced AI systems whose actions might be misaligned with human values or could spiral beyond human control.

Examples of Existential Risk

Advanced AI Systems: Highly autonomous AI systems, if not properly aligned with human values, could execute tasks in destructive ways. For example, an AI designed to maximize production efficiency might deplete natural resources rapidly, causing ecological disasters. This misalignment can lead to catastrophic outcomes, where AI-driven actions inadvertently cause irreversible damage to the environment and disrupt ecological balance.

AI in Warfare: Autonomous weapons powered by AI could lead to new forms of warfare, with potential escalations to catastrophic levels if these systems act unpredictably or are hacked to perform unintended operations. This technology, if misused, could result in unprecedented destruction, challenging the current frameworks of international warfare and humanitarian laws.

AI-Induced Unemployment: The rapid advancement and deployment of AI in various sectors could lead to widespread unemployment, social unrest, and economic disparities, creating destabilizing effects on society. The displacement of human labor by artificial intelligence could exacerbate inequality, leading to significant socio-economic challenges and potentially triggering political upheaval.

AI and Privacy Erosion: AI systems capable of mass surveillance could lead to unprecedented invasions of privacy, potentially leading to oppressive, authoritarian regimes, thus threatening the fabric of democratic societies. This erosion of privacy rights could fundamentally alter the nature of individual freedom, leading to a society where personal data is constantly monitored and exploited.

Use Cases of Existential Risk

AI in Climate Modeling: AI systems used in climate prediction and modeling might incorrectly assess risks, leading to inadequate responses to climate emergencies, potentially accelerating environmental degradation. Inaccurate models could misguide policy decisions, leading to insufficient or misguided efforts to combat climate change, exacerbating its impacts.

AI in Financial Markets: AI algorithms managing large portions of financial trading could misinterpret market data, leading to massive economic disruptions and crises. Such miscalculations of big data could trigger financial instability, affecting global economies, and potentially leading to severe economic downturns similar to the 2008 financial crisis.

AI in Healthcare: An AI system in healthcare making erroneous decisions could lead to widespread misdiagnoses or inappropriate treatments, endangering countless lives. These inaccuracies could undermine trust in medical systems, leading to public health crises and eroding the foundational trust in healthcare professionals.

AI in Social Media: AI algorithms driving social media platforms could inadvertently promote harmful content, influencing public opinion negatively and destabilizing societies. Such manipulation could distort democratic processes, spread misinformation at an unprecedented scale, and exacerbate social divisions, leading to widespread societal unrest.

FAQs

What is the biggest existential risk posed by AI?

AI’s potential to develop autonomous decision-making capabilities beyond human control presents a significant existential risk. This includes scenarios where AI systems might act based on misaligned objectives or interpret commands in harmful ways.

How can existential risks from AI be mitigated?

Mitigating existential risks involves developing robust AI safety and ethics guidelines, ensuring AI systems align with human values, and establishing international regulations to prevent harmful AI applications, especially in areas like autonomous weapons.

Are there any examples of AI existential risks occurring?

While no catastrophic AI existential risks have materialized, concerns are growing around AI’s impact on privacy, social manipulation, and autonomous weaponry, which demonstrate potential pathways to existential risks.

Is AI existential risk a concern for the near future?

Yes, as AI technology rapidly advances, existential risks become more plausible, particularly in areas like autonomous weapons, privacy erosion, and misaligned AI objectives, necessitating immediate attention and preventive measures.
